Output ff1d64d0ca25cee90b0129a3fa10f94fa8f1d4e235bdf5ea104b89c8d6f5615a:0

value
22548146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edaf1f8c4c4620663f7af52efa6cc5e73f5f247 OP_EQUAL
address
3DFmMHzML3Pyzi1xjeq4ikn1JH6Vsjs6qm
transaction
ff1d64d0ca25cee90b0129a3fa10f94fa8f1d4e235bdf5ea104b89c8d6f5615a
confirmations
288750
spent
true